iPhone 6 Vs. Samsung Galaxy S4: Which One Is Worth The Wait?

Samsung and Apple are always going head-to-head as far as smartphones are concerned. While the debate raged on with before and after the release of the popular Galaxy S3 and iPhone 5, the same has already started with the heavily rumored Galaxy S4 and iPhone 6, respectively.

While comparisons have already started between the two, the fact here is that nothing clearly is known about these next generation smartphones with different kinds of rumors arriving almost every day.

New reports have claimed that the iPhone 6 will feature a "Super HD" screen display and camera that will be beyond the Full HD displays in HTC Droid DNA. This was previously backed by Jefferies stock analyst Peter Misek, who stated that "the iPhone 5S/6 has a new 'super HD camera/screen, a better battery, and NFC,' and 'possible updates include an IGZO screen for Retina+, 128GB storage."

The Samsung Galaxy S4, on the other hand, could boast a massive 5-inch display which introduces it into the Galaxy Note-styled phablet category. It is also said to have a 13 megapixel rear camera, a bigger battery and the new EXYNOS 5440 quad-core processor, which will make the device thicker.

Nonetheless, both are highly anticipated, to say the least, and here is a comparison to show what is known as of now and what is rumored.

Screen: The Samsung Galaxy S4 is said to sport 5-inches Super AMOLED touchscreen with 1080x1920 pixel resolutions. Several other rumors say that the S4 could also be equipped with flexible screen displays. The upcoming iPhone 6, on the other hand, is also speculated to arrive with a 5-inch Full HD display.

Camera: The exact megapixel of iPhone 6's camera is still unknown but rumor doing rounds on the Internet state that the device will have a super HD camera. In comparison, the Galaxy S4 is said to arrive with a 13 megapixel rear camera.

Operating System: Although nothing can be said surely, as far as the device operating systems are concerned, Samsung Galaxy S4 is rumored to run the upcoming version of the Android called Key Lime Pie or even the new mobile software TIZEN OS. Apple's iPhone 6, however, on the other hand, is speculated to run with iOS 7.

Processors: While the Galaxy S4, as most Web sites state, is said to arrive with 8-core processor paired with 2GB RAM, the next iPhone is also speculated to be powered by a next generation A6 chip.

Storage (Internal): This category is expected to remain the same with the Galaxy S4 expected to have 16GB, 32GB and 64GB worth of internal storage with expected additional storage via microSD slot. The iPhone 6, comparatively, is said to offer a 128GB avatar as well.

Miscellaneous: Both devices are expected to arrive with support for 4G/LTE connectivity and NFC (Near Field Communication). All eyes will be on the next iPhone if the Cupertino-based company will finally introduce the NFC technology. This will be a major deciding factor following Apple's decision of not including the technology in the previous iPhone 5 that casted an image in the number of iPhone 5 sales.
